Parking lot repair services involve addressing issues related to the surface integrity of commercial, industrial, or residential parking areas. These services typically include fixing cracks, potholes, and surface deformations to restore a smooth and safe driving and walking surface. Repair professionals may also perform patching, resurfacing, and sealing to pr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of the parking lot. Proper repair work helps maintain the functionality and appearance of the lot, ensuring it remains safe and accessible for users.

These services are essential for solving common problems such as surface cracking, pothole formation, uneven pavement, and drainage issues. Left unaddressed, these problems can lead to vehicle damage, safety hazards, and increased maintenance costs. Repair specialists assess the condition of the existing surface and implement targeted solutions to eliminate hazards and improve the overall condition of the parking lot. Regular repairs can also help prevent more extensive and costly reconstruction projects in the future.

The process of parking lot repair typically involves a thorough assessment of the existing surface to identify areas in need of attention. Repair contractors then prepare the surface by cleaning and removing damaged material before applying appropriate repair methods. Depending on the severity of the damage, solutions may include patching potholes, filling cracks, leveling uneven surfaces, or applying sealcoats and overlays. These services help extend the life of the parking lot, enhance safety, and improve the overall appearance of the property.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for parking lot repairs range from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or crack repairs may cost around $500, while larger surface replacements can exceed $10,000. Variations depend on size and condition of the lot.

Resurfacing Expenses - Resurfacing a parking lot generally costs between $3,000 and $10,000. Smaller lots or those requiring minimal prep might be closer to $3,000, whereas extensive resurfacing for larger areas can approach $15,000 or more.

Sealcoating Prices - Sealcoating services typically range from $0.15 to $0.25 per square foot. For an average-sized lot of 10,000 square feet, costs may fall between $1,500 and $2,500. The price varies based on surface condition and the sealant used.

Additional Expenses - Cost factors such as line striping, signage, or drainage improvements can add $500 to $2,000 or more. These extras depend on the specific needs of the parking lot and the scope of work required by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of parking lot repairs are available? Local service providers offer a range of repairs including crack filling, pothole patching, seal coating, and surface resurfacing to address various parking lot issues.

How can I determine if my parking lot needs repairs? Signs such as large cracks, potholes, fading markings, or water pooling may indicate the need for professional assessment and repair services.

What are common causes of parking lot damage? Heavy traffic, weather conditions, poor initial construction, and lack of maintenance can lead to cracks, potholes, and surface deterioration.

How long do parking lot repairs typically last? The longevity of repairs depends on the type of work performed, materials used, and maintenance, with many repairs lasting several years when properly maintained.
